The Supermarket and Hypermarket sector is another crucial segment driving the demand for land planning and development services. Supermarkets and hypermarkets require strategic locations with ample space for large retail stores, parking lots, and distribution centers. The demand for such large-scale retail outlets has grown with increasing consumer preference for one-stop shopping experiences. Retail developers need to consider consumer traffic patterns, zoning regulations, and proximity to residential areas when planning land use for supermarkets and hypermarkets. Efficient land planning in this sector ensures that these large retail stores are situated in locations that maximize foot traffic, improve accessibility for customers, and comply with local regulations. Moreover, with the growth of e-commerce, supermarkets and hypermarkets are also integrating online sales channels, requiring additional logistical and storage solutions to be incorporated into their land development plans. Convenience Stores, which often focus on providing customers with quick access to essential goods, represent another significant application within the land planning and development market. Convenience stores are typically small in size and are strategically placed in high-traffic areas such as near residential neighborhoods, gas stations, and transportation hubs. Effective land planning in this segment focuses on identifying prime locations that will attract foot traffic while maintaining efficient store layouts and accessibility. Developers working on land planning for convenience stores also need to account for factors like parking, zoning regulations, and proximity to competitors, ensuring that the stores meet the needs of their target customer base. Furthermore, as consumer preferences shift towards healthier food options and technological integration, convenience store developers are increasingly considering these trends when planning land use and store layouts.
